Weather in August

August is characterized by a consistent weather pattern similar to July. As Moroni navigates through August, the city experiences the lowest rainfall levels in the year, reaching down to 12mm (0.47"). Long sunny days become a common sight, providing ample time for outdoor activities. August is ideal for beach trips, with the sea water temperature being just right. The decrease in sea temperature gives way to a unique cool feeling that is refreshing to bathers.

Temperature

July through September, with an average high-temperature of 25.3°C (77.5°F), are marked as the coldest months.

Humidity

July and August, with an average relative humidity of 74%, are the least humid months in Moroni.

Rainfall

In August, in Moroni, the rain falls for 10.3 days. Throughout August, 12mm (0.47") of precipitation is accumulated. In Moroni, during the entire year, the rain falls for 187.6 days and collects up to 1082mm (42.6") of precipitation.

Sea temperature

August is the month with the coldest seawater in Moroni, with an average sea temperature of 25°C (77°F).
Note: With water temperature from 25°C (77°F) to 29°C (84.2°F), all water activities are comfortable and delightful, devoid of discomfort even for lengthened periods.

Daylight

In August, the average length of the day is 11h and 44min.
On the first day of August in Moroni, Comoros, sunrise is at 06:25 and sunset at 18:01.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:10 and sunset at 18:03 EAT.

Sunshine

In August, the average sunshine in Moroni is 9.3h.

UV index

July and August, with an average maximum UV index of 6, are months with the lowest UV index in Moroni. A UV Index estimate of 6 to 7 represents a high health risk from exposure to the Sun's UV radiation for ordinary individuals.
Note: The UV index of 6 during August leads to these advisories:
Take precautions against overexposure. Protection against sun damage is needed. Avoid direct Sun exposure and seek shade between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., when UV radiation is at its peak, but keep in mind that not all shade structures provide complete protection. Wearing a wide-brim hat can block approximately 50% of UV radiation, protecting the eyes. Caution! The mirror effect of sand and water ups the UV radiation strength.
